How to Enable/Unhide Administrator Account in Windows XP Pro Welcome Screen Logon

1. Click Start then click Run.

At Run. Type control userpasswords2. Then press Enter or click OK.

2. At User Accounts, check/enable the checkbox Users must enter a user name and password to use this computer, so that you’ll able see it on the Windows Welcome Screen Logon.

3. Click to Advanced Tab, go to Advanced user management, click Advanced.

4. It will show the Local Users and Groups. Click on Users, then right-click to Administrator, and then click to Properties.

(Note : You can also access Local Users and Groups, click Start > Settings > Control Panel, then click to Administrative Tools, click Computer Management, then click to Local Users and Groups)

5. Administrator Properties appears, at General Tab, uncheck the checkbox on Account is disabled. (Make sure the box is uncheck) Then click Apply and afterwards click OK.

6. Click Start then click Run, then this time type: regedit

Navigate to following folder: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Winlogon\SpecialAccounts\UserList

7. Double-click on Administrator key, if doesn’t exist, right-click on the panel (same folder) then choose New then select DWORD Value. Name the new DWORD Value as Administrator.

Double click the Administrator, at the Value data, type 1, then click OK.

8. Check the Administrator status is enable, to do that, click Start > Settings > Control Panel, then click to Administrative Tools, click Local Security Policy, then Local Policies and then click to Security Options.

9. From the right panel, you will see the Policy and Security Settings. Check on Accounts: Administrator account status if it’s Enable. If not, Double-click it and change to Enabled.

After the settings all complete, restart your computer, you’ll able to see the administrator on the Windows XP Welcome Logon Screen.

How to Disable/Hide the Administrator Account? Simple. You can reverse the process of this tutorial. 🙂
